Calcaneal fracture - Sanders type 3ac

Diagnosis certain

Presentation

Acute pain on right foot after a 2,5 m fall from roof.

Patient Data

Age: 60 years
Gender: Male

Intraarticular calcaneal fractures involving the posterior facet of the calcaneus.

There are primary intra-articular fracture lines extending through lateral and medial aspects of the calcaneus, consistent with type 3ac of Sanders CT classification.

Case Discussion

The majority of calcaneal fractures are intra-articular (up to 75% of cases), and they are usually caused by a fall from a height with one or both heels directly hitting the ground 1. Almost all of the intra-articular fractures culminate with displacement, and although it normally is as little as 2 mm, it might be sufficient to alter pressure in the subtalar joint. Therefore, displaced intra-articular calcaneal fractures are complex and highly disabling injuries 2.
